Bitcoin Whales Load Up on $1.2 Billion BTC Amid ETF Inflows
Bitcoin whales have been accumulating a significant amount of BTC since July 29, adding over 20,000 BTC worth $1.2 billion to their holdings.
This accumulation comes as U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s attracted roughly $754.69 million in investor funds this week, marking one of the best weeks for these funds since April.
The recent influx of capital into these ETFs may indicate a tentative recovery in institutional demand for Bitcoin, although the spot price has not yet reflected this with a meaningful rally.
In contrast to some predictions that the Clarity Act would unlock a massive institutional bid for crypto, uncertainty around the act and stagnant price action have been cited as risks for broader momentum.
